    When checking out items in the WooCommerce page, I get a 403 (Forbidden) Error.

    Error Message in the Console is:

    jquery.min.js?ver=3.7.1:2       

    GET https://autobadge.org/carbadges/home/?wc-ajax=update_order_review 403 (Forbidden)

    The Cart page works fine but the checkout page doesn’t. I have done the following troubleshooting:

    • Disabled all Plugins except WooCommerce
    • Deactivated and reactivated WooCommerce
    • Set the Theme to default Twenty Twenty Four
    • Checked Permalink settings and resaved them
    • Checked the htcaccess file
    • Reviewed the WooCommerce Settings
    • Check Permissions and they are correct 0644 for files and 0755 for folders
    • Updated all Plugins, Themes, Databases etc
    • Deleted and Reinstalled WooCommerce
    • Contacted Hostgator who hosts the website and they checked the index.php files and PHP Version, they also whitelisted the rule IDs and checked file permissions.

    I am not sure what else to try. Any help would be greatly appreciated. Thanks!

    I solved this and thought I’d put the answer here in case anyone else had the issue.

    I edited the checkout page and removed everything from that page. Then I added the WooCommerce block back in and converted it to Blocks.

    Seems like a simple solution now.
